updated boa to latest beta release to fix incompatibility issues with

the IPv6 code syntax.
For IRIX 5 socklen_t does not exist and is therefore redefined to int.
This commit is contained in:
Georg Schwarz 2005-08-07 20:27:51 +00:00 committed by Thomas Klausner
parent af896190d5
commit 417dc8dff8
3 changed files with 23 additions and 12 deletions

View file

@ -1,18 +1,21 @@
DISTNAME= boa-0.94.13
DISTNAME= boa-0.94.14rc21
CATEGORIES= www
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=boa/}
MASTER_SITES= http://www.boa.org/
HOMEPAGE= http://www.boa.org/
COMMENT= a small HTTP server
MAINTAINER= schwarz@netbsd.org
MAINTAINER= schwarz@NetBSD.org
C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R}/boa
EGDIR= ${PREFIX}/share/examples/boa
GNU_CONFIGURE= YES
USE_TOOLS+= gmake lex
WRKSRC= ${WRKDIR}/${DISTNAME}/src
.include "../../mk/bsd.prefs.mk"
.if !empty(LOWER_OPSYS:Mirix5*)
CPPFLAGS+= -Dsocklen_t=int
.endif
BUILD_DEFS+= USE_INET6
.if defined (USE_INET6) && !empty(USE_INET6:M[Yy][Ee][Ss])
CPPFLAGS+= -DINET6
@ -21,11 +24,16 @@ CPPFLAGS+= -DINET6
INSTALLATION_DIRS= sbin man/man8
do-install:
${INSTALL_PROGRAM} ${WRKSRC}/boa ${WRKSRC}/boa_indexer ${PREFIX}/sbin
${INSTALL_PROGRAM} ${WRKSRC}/src/boa \
${WRKSRC}/src/boa_indexer ${PREFIX}/sbin
${INSTALL_DATA_DIR} ${EGDIR}
${INSTALL_DATA} ${WRKDIR}/${DISTNAME}/boa.conf ${EGDIR}
${INSTALL_DATA} ${WRKSRC}/examples/boa.conf \
${WRKSRC}/examples/cgi-test.cgi \
${WRKSRC}/examples/nph-test.cgi \
${WRKSRC}/examples/resolver.pl ${EGDIR}
${INSTALL_DATA_DIR} ${PREFIX}/share/doc/boa
${INSTALL_DATA} ${WRKDIR}/${DISTNAME}/CREDITS ${WRKDIR}/${DISTNAME}/README ${PREFIX}/share/doc/boa
${INSTALL_MAN} ${WRKDIR}/${DISTNAME}/docs/boa.8 ${PREFIX}/man/man8
${INSTALL_DATA} ${WRKSRC}/CREDITS ${WRKSRC}/README \
${PREFIX}/share/doc/boa
${INSTALL_MAN} ${WRKSRC}/docs/boa.8 ${PREFIX}/man/man8
.include "../../mk/bsd.pkg.mk"

View file

@ -1,6 +1,9 @@
sbin/boa
sbin/boa_indexer
share/examples/boa/boa.conf
share/examples/boa/cgi-test.cgi
share/examples/boa/nph-test.cgi
share/examples/boa/resolver.pl
share/doc/boa/CREDITS
share/doc/boa/README
man/man8/boa.8

View file

@ -1,5 +1,5 @@
$NetBSD: distinfo,v 1.1 2005/03/13 00:34:02 gschwarz Exp $
$NetBSD: distinfo,v 1.2 2005/08/07 20:27:53 gschwarz Exp $
SHA1 (boa-0.94.13.tar.gz) = 7ce96f6d917baf328449be7f40783156afe634cb
RMD160 (boa-0.94.13.tar.gz) = 00210b478eda27896873f106401cfb3c6362fd52
Size (boa-0.94.13.tar.gz) = 122066 bytes
SHA1 (boa-0.94.14rc21.tar.gz) = c801876113d31e45e2745c081ab7905fdc679236
RMD160 (boa-0.94.14rc21.tar.gz) = e187a4e21a81a8454f6f08dc2372496e89963a0f
Size (boa-0.94.14rc21.tar.gz) = 199950 bytes